In our Paris to Budapest EV duel, the Tesla Model Y beats the Vinfast VF8 by 19 minutes, completing the 1480km route in 14h 33min. The key advantage? 1 fewer charging stop. Route calculated on September 6, 2026 using real-time charging station data.
The Vinfast VF8's 376km range doesn't beat the Tesla Model Y's 344km here - charging speed and efficiency matter more.
The Tesla Model Y needs only 7 charging stops compared to 8 for the slowest vehicle, saving valuable time.

Why the Tesla Model Y Won
The Tesla Model Y achieved a 19-minute advantage over Vinfast VF8 on this 1480km route. Key factors:
- Fewer charging stops: 7 stops vs 8 for the slowest vehicle means less time spent finding and connecting to chargers.
- Faster charging: Total charging time of 1h 15min vs 1h 32min thanks to higher peak charging speeds or better charging curve.
